Transaction 8f23abc546eb1e34c894b53d9b2c4c2f5a3320c7506d9568e3b0ad29eb95c9ba

3 Input
1 Outputs
  • 8f23abc546eb1e34c894b53d9b2c4c2f5a3320c7506d9568e3b0ad29eb95c9ba:0
  • value  4288566
    address  33XMnDWdGkSzigrb92ghWrxJacocs9Lt8h